Routine maintenance procedures need to be performed by the users to make the ice bath water treatment function properly. Clean the tank every week to remove mineral buildup or chemical residue. Scaling and corrosion are prevented through the use of distilled water. Dry parts completely after cleaning before filling up. The heating coil and temperature sensor should be checked for build-up or debris. Electrical components should not be submerged in water when cleaning. Proper routine maintenance makes the ice bath water treatment accurate, safe, and efficient to utilize over a long period of time.

Q: What is the primary function of a water bath in the laboratory? A: A water bath is used to maintain samples at a constant temperature for extended periods, providing stable heating conditions for experiments and reactions. Q: Why is distilled water recommended for use in a water bath? A: Distilled water is preferred because it prevents mineral buildup, reduces corrosion, and helps extend the lifespan of the equipment. Q: How often should the water in a water bath be replaced? A:When contamination or visible residue occurs, it should be replaced at least once a week or more frequently to ensure cleanliness and accurate heating performance. Q: What safety measures should be taken when operating a water bath? A: Users should avoid overfilling, keep electrical components dry, and regularly check temperature controls to prevent overheating or short circuits. Q: Can a water bath be used for heating flammable liquids? A: No, flammable liquids should never be heated in a water bath, as vapors can ignite when exposed to heat or electrical sparks.
